Hitron Coda 56 activated but no increase in speed

I recently replaced my existing modem with a Hitron Coda 56 to take advantage of the upgraded internet plan, but I am not seeing an increase in speed. I am seeing a slight increase in the download, as I was already provisioned for 1.25 Gbps, but I am seeing no change in the upload (still at ~35 Mbps). Is there something else I need to do or is there a configuration change that needs to occur to take advantage of the increase? I did see other posts recommending to make sure there are no other modems on the account, but I can not find a place to remove the prior one. When I interact with the AI agent, it does ask me to choose the correct one from my new one and old one. Any ideas?

I believe was on a grandfathered setup and my account needed to be re-appointed for the changes to be in effect. Once updated, I just needed to reboot the modem and all is good.
